Meet Our Featured Equine

Hermes - Hermes is a 14-18 year old, bay, Arabian gelding. Hermes is broke to ride and is a beautiful mover. He has potential as a show or pleasure horse.

For most of us, I don't think horse rescue is a choice. We do it because we can - and because we have to. We look in their eyes, we hear their stories, and the choice is made. We will help because we couldn't not help.
BEHS President Jennifer Williams, March 13, 2009
